技术文摘
重敲代码胜拷贝粘贴
2024-12-31 16:47:41 小编
重敲代码胜拷贝粘贴
在当今数字化的时代,编程已经成为一项至关重要的技能。然而,在编程的过程中,许多人往往倾向于使用拷贝粘贴的方式来完成任务,认为这样可以节省时间和精力。但事实上,重敲代码才是真正能够提升编程能力、实现个人成长的正确途径。
拷贝粘贴虽然看似快捷,能够在短时间内完成代码的编写,但它带来的问题也不容忽视。通过拷贝粘贴得到的代码,我们可能并不理解其内在的逻辑和原理。当遇到问题需要修改或优化时,就会显得束手无策,因为我们只是机械地复制了代码,而没有真正掌握其核心。
而重敲代码则是一个深入学习的过程。当我们亲自敲下每一行代码时,我们需要思考代码的作用、逻辑关系以及可能出现的问题。这个过程不仅能够加深我们对编程语言的理解,还能够培养我们的逻辑思维能力和解决问题的能力。例如,在学习一个新的算法时,通过自己动手实现,我们能够更加清晰地理解算法的每一个步骤,从而更好地掌握它。
重敲代码还能够提高我们的代码质量。在敲代码的过程中,我们会更加注重代码的规范性、可读性和可维护性。我们会思考如何设计更加合理的代码结构,如何选择合适的变量名和函数名,以及如何进行错误处理等。这些都是优秀程序员所必备的素养,而拷贝粘贴无法让我们获得这些宝贵的经验。
当然,这并不是说拷贝粘贴就完全没有用处。在某些情况下,我们可以参考他人的优秀代码来学习和借鉴。但关键是,我们不能仅仅依赖于拷贝粘贴,而是要在理解的基础上,通过自己的努力去重敲代码,将他人的经验转化为自己的能力。
重敲代码胜拷贝粘贴。只有通过自己的实践和努力,我们才能真正掌握编程的精髓,提升自己的编程水平,在这个数字化的时代中脱颖而出。
- JavaScript程序查找矩阵中每一行的最大元素
- Vue框架中实现海量数据统计图表的方法
- Vue 处理图片缓存与预加载的方法
- Vue实现图片裂变与特效处理的方法
- Vue中v-for无法正确进行列表渲染报错的解决方法
- 用CSS和JavaScript创建自定义范围滑块的方法
- 在HTML中创建预格式化文本的方法
- HTML中怎样添加多语言内容
- JavaScript程序实现用于数组旋转的块交换算法
- 在JavaScript中对累加器和对象的每个键应用函数的方法
- Vue报错解决:v-model无法实现双向数据绑定
- Vue实现图片线条和形状绘制的方法
- Vue实现图片裂变与抽象处理的方法
- Vue统计图表动态筛选与聚类优化
- JavaScript查找数组元素的或与操作